Quentin Tarantino wants to make Ringo Starr a movie star

Filmmaker Quentin Tarantino is keen on casting Beatles legend Ringo Starr in an upcoming film.

Washington, Sept 29 : Filmmaker Quentin Tarantino is keen on casting Beatles legend Ringo Starr in an upcoming film.

Pulp Fiction director is impressed with the drummer's presence onstage and believes he has the capacity to do justice to the role.

"I'm Elvis over the Beatles any day of the week but there's always been something special about Ringo," Contactmusic quoted Tarantino, as saying.

"I've always thought he had the best stage presence in the band," he said.

The cult filmmaker, who is a big fan of 1970's European soft-core sex films, recently revealed that he is keen on making an erotic film.
